A resume, cover letter, and completed application are required to be considered for position. **Please note, this is a hybrid role.** Position Summary Grow your career and join the UCLA Alumni Career Engagement team! As an Assistant Director, you will expand and showcase your skills as you lead the strategy, daily management, and growth of UCLA ONE - our premier networking platform - and drive engagement across our digital communities, including LinkedIn, social media, the Alumni Association website, and email channels. You will manage projects with a purpose and provide collaborative input to ensure digital experiences expand, enhance and are responsive to the needs of our diverse alumni communities. Partnering with members of the Alumni Career Engagement team and other teams across External Affairs, you will advance our platforms, identify opportunities to improve user experiences, and be part of the vital storytelling of our alumni across industries. As an Assistant Director, your work will help create meaningful mentorship programs and engagement opportunities that connect Bruins for real-world career training and insights.
